Basudebpur Population - Purba Medinipur, West Bengal

Basudebpur is a medium size village located in Potashpur - I Block of Purba Medinipur district, West Bengal with total 160 families residing. The Basudebpur village has population of 693 of which 360 are males while 333 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Basudebp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 58 which makes up 8.37 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Basudebpur village is 925 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Basudebpur as per census is 871, lower than West Bengal average of 956.

Basudebpur village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Basudebpur village was 93.86 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Basudebpur Male literacy stands at 96.05 % while female literacy rate was 91.50 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 5.63 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.14 % of total population in Basudebpur village.

Work Profile

In Basudebpur village out of total population, 248 were engaged in work activities. 67.74 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 32.26 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 248 workers engaged in Main Work, 28 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 34 were Agricultural labourer.
